Ruby Falls has honored three employees with the annual John T. Steiner, Sr. Memorial Scholarship. They are Alyssa Boates-Miller, Libby Worely and McKenzie Morgan.
This scholarship awards employees who are outstanding students in college, selected by a scholarship committee. Mo Steiner, widow of Jack Steiner, Sr., represents the Steiner family in awarding the memorandums annually.
Ms. Boates-Miller is an accountancy major at University of Memphis and has worked at Ruby Falls for five years. She participates in Jesus Cares, an organization that seeks to provide Christmas presents and dinner to those less fortunate in the community. When not studying or working, she enjoys embroidery and sewing in her spare time.
Ms. Worely is an engineering major at UTC and has worked at Ruby Falls for over a year. She attended East Ridge High, where she was vice president of her class as well as parliamentarian. She has worked with Girls on the Run, Girls Inc. and volunteered for Take Back the Night and the Scenic City Marathon.
Ms. Morgan also attends UTC and is currently studying exercise science. She is a member of the Freshman Leadership at UTC’s Baptist Collegiate Ministry, a part of UTC’s club soccer team and has participated in many mission trips through First Baptist of South Pittsburg. Ms. Morgan has worked at Ruby Falls for two years.
